Grand Clergy of the Scorpion Queen

Founded by the original worshippers of Moruba, the Scorpion Queen, this members of this clergy are directly descended from them. The queen's personal Royal Priestess is chosen from this pool of clergy members.

Mythology & Lore

The Dark Elves were said to have come from an ancient Elven race, and they were cursed by Baresis because the Trogur pantheon caught them being curious about worshipping the three gods that would one day be the Galuesa pantheon. The Dark Elves were then banished to the Underground, but blessed by Moruba to see better in the darkness, and even flourish there. They have now made their home in the Dark Elf Boroughs.

Worship

When a visitor to the temple wants to pray, they approach a Monk on duty in the temple. They will fetch a lantern holding incense and fuel, and the worshipper will kneel in front of one of the altars. While the Monk carries the lit incense to the altar, the worshipper says a prayer, and the Monk detaches the lantern from it's handle to place the incense on the altar. The worshipper finishes their prayer, and the Monk says a few words of blessing. This concludes the prayer.   Many Dark Elves have a small altar and some incense sticks at home for quick prayers. Small scorpion idols are commonly carried, and small idols of Moruba are usually placed on the home altar.

Priesthood

The position of Royal Priestess is the highest one can attain, and both it and the higher positions in the clergy are reserved for women. The High Priestesses answer to her, and sometimes come from the Grand Temple to check on the other temples. Beneath those are the Priestesses: they manage the daily matters of a temple. Under her are the Monks: almost exclusively a male position, and the highest they can attain in the clergy.
